Google has rolled out an update to fix the blurry video problem in Gemini Live's camera sharing feature, improving resolution and user experience for Android users.
Google has recently rolled out an update to address a persistent issue affecting the video quality in its Gemini Live feature on Android devices. The update specifically targets and improves the camera resolution within the app, enhancing the overall user experience
1
.Gemini Live, a feature of Google's conversational AI assistant, allows users to share their camera feed with the AI, enabling it to answer questions about what it sees in real-time. This functionality, part of Project Astra, was first introduced at Google I/O 2024 and has quickly become an indispensable tool for many users seeking immediate, context-aware information on the go
2
.Source: Android Police
Users had been reporting issues with blurry video when sharing their camera with Gemini Live on the Android Gemini mobile app. This problem not only affected the AI's ability to accurately detect and analyze objects in view but also posed potential challenges for users with accessibility needs
2
.The issue appears to have persisted for at least a month, as evidenced by user complaints on various platforms, including Reddit. Google acknowledged the problem and promptly worked on a solution to maintain the quality and reliability of its flagship AI tool
2
.Google's Gemini Apps Team announced the fix on their community page, stating that the update "improves the camera resolution in the app"
1
. The fix has been implemented as a server-side rollout, meaning users don't need to manually update their Gemini app to benefit from the improvement2
.For users who may still experience issues after the update, Google recommends sending detailed feedback through the app. This can be done by accessing the profile menu at the top of the page and selecting the Feedback option
1
.

Alongside the video quality fix, Google has made other recent changes to Gemini Live:
Expanded functionality: Users can now perform actions in other Google apps during a Gemini Live conversation. This feature has been extended to some Samsung apps for Galaxy users
1
.Removal of swipe gesture: The convenient left swipe gesture to access Gemini Live from the home screen has been removed for Android users. Currently, the dedicated Gemini Live icon remains the primary way to access the conversational AI on Android devices
2
